About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c

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c (EIN: 208969896) is a nonprofit organization based in Green Bay, WI, classified under NTEE code E990. The organization reported total revenue of $5.8M and total assets of $8.0M according to its most recent IRS 990 filing.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c showing financial trends over 13 years of public records:

Over 13 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c's revenue has grown by 441.9%, moving from $1.3M to $6.8M. Total assets increased by 513.7% over the same period, from $1.3M to $7.7M. Total functional expenses rose by 378.7%, from $1.2M to $5.6M. In its most recent filing year (2023),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c reported a surplus of $1.2M,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$748K in liabilities against $7.7M in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 9.7%), resulting in net assets of $6.9M.

Data Sources and Methodology

This transparency report for Brown County Oral Healthpartnership Inc is generated by NonprofitSpending's AI analysis engine. The data is sourced from publicly available IRS 990 filings accessed through the ProPublica Nonprofit Explorer API and IRS electronic filing records. The Mission Score, spending breakdown, and other analytical insights are produced by artificial intelligence and should be used as one of multiple factors when evaluating a nonprofit organization.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ers. NonprofitSpending processes this data to provide accessible transparency reports for donors, researchers, and the general public.
